Palma work accident leaves façade worker seriously injured
A 44-year-old façade worker was seriously injured in a work accident in Palma, Mallorca, on 17 August after falling from the fifth floor of a building on Carrer Metge Josep Darder. The fall occurred at about 12.30pm while he was carrying out maintenance work for a company specialising in work at height.
Initial inquiries indicate that the worker had been trying to replace the rope connected to his safety harness when its fixing failed. He struck a heavy vehicle used by the work crew before landing in the road.
He sustained multiple fractures and may also have suffered spinal injuries. Emergency service 061 took him to Son Espases University Hospital, where he was admitted in a serious condition.
The National Police are investigating the incident as a suspected workplace accident, while Palma Local Police managed traffic to allow emergency teams to work. The Balearic Institute for Occupational Safety and Health is also examining the cause of the fall and is monitoring the worker’s medical condition.
